Service Reductions & Fare Increases Necessary
With the State’s elimination of Redevelopment Agencies, the financial support for the Downtown-Waterfront Shuttle, the Crosstown Shuttle, and the Commuter Lot Shuttle services that the City of Santa Barbara has provided for many years is no longer available. Seaside Shuttle fares have been increased as well.
